问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

数据库中第一范式,第二范式,第三范式、、、是什么,怎么区分?

发布网友 发布时间:2022-04-23 05:40

我来回答

10个回答

热心网友 时间:2022-04-07 16:45

第一范式:一言以蔽之:“第一范式的数据表必须是二维数据表”,第一范式是指数据库的每一列都是不可分割的基本数据项,强调列的原子性,试题中某一属性不能拥有几个值。比如数据库的电话号码属性里面不可以有固定电话和移动电话值。 说明:在任何一个关系数据库中,第一范式(1NF)是对关系模式的基本要求,不满足第一范式(1NF)的数据库就不是关系数据库。

第二范式建立在第一范式的基础上,即满足第二范式一定满足第一范式,第二范式要求数据表每一个实例或者行必须被唯一标识。除满足第一范式外还有两个条件,一是表必须有一个主键;二是没有包含在主键中的列必须完全依赖于主键,而不能只依赖于主键的一部分。每一行的数据只能与其中一列相关,即一行数据只做一件事。只要数据列中出现数据重复,就要把表拆分开来。

第三范式若某一范式是第二范式,且每一个非主属性都不传递依赖于该范式的候选键,则称为第三范式,即不能存在:非主键列 A 依赖于非主键列 B,非主键列 B 依赖于主键的情况。

扩展资料:

范式是符合某一种级别的关系模式的集合。关系数据库中的关系必须满足一定的要求,满足不同程度要求的为不同范式。

参考资料:范式百度百科

热心网友 时间:2022-04-07 18:03

第一范式:(1NF)无重复的列

第二范式:(2NF)属性完全依赖于主键

第三范式:(3NF)属性不依赖于其它非主属性

范式,数据库设计范式,数据库的设计范式,是符合某一种级别的关系模式的集合。构造数据库必须遵循一定的规则。在关系数据库中,这种规则就是范式。

关系数据库中的关系必须满足一定的要求,即满足不同的范式。目前关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、Boyce-Codd范式(BCNF)、第四范式(4NF)和第五范式(5NF)。满足最低要求的范式是第一范式(1NF)。

在第一范式的基础上进一步满足更多要求的称为第二范式(2NF),其余范式以次类推。一般说来,数据库只需满足第三范式(3NF)就行了。下面我们举例介绍第一范式(1NF)、第二范式(2NF)和第三范式(3NF)。

在创建一个数据库的过程中,范化是将其转化为一些表的过程,这种方法可以使从数据库得到的结果更加明确。这样可能使数据库产生重复数据,从而导致创建多余的表。范化是在识别数据库中的数据元素、关系,以及定义所需的表和各表中的项目这些初始工作之后的一个细化的过程。

热心网友 时间:2022-04-07 19:37

我给你解释下,他们说的都照本宣科。
第一范式,说的是数据库要划分出多个实体,就是基础表。
第二范式,说的是实体唯一性,每一行用主键区分,所以主键不能重复,主键后面跟着的都是该实体的属性。
第三范式,说的是实体和实体之间的联系,就是关联表,他们之间用主键连起来,又叫外键关联。

热心网友 时间:2022-04-07 21:29

第一范式:(1NF)无重复的列
第二范式:(2NF)属性完全依赖于主键
第三范式:(3NF)属性不依赖于其它非主属性

楼主问题中要的就是概念,可是还嫌晕,没办法啊,概念就是概念,结合实际理解一下就好了。

详细的解释可见:
http://zhidao.baidu.com/question/98317025.html?fr=ala0

热心网友 时间:2022-04-07 23:37

若每个属性不能再分为简单项,则它属于第一范式

热心网友 时间:2022-04-08 02:18

能举个具体点的例子不?

热心网友 时间:2022-04-08 05:16

若R∈1NF,且每一个非主属性完全函数依赖于任何一个候选码,则R∈2NF
若R∈3NF,则每一个非主属性既不传递也不依赖于码,也不部分依赖于码。也就是说,可以证明如果R属于3NF,则必有R属于2NF

热心网友 时间:2022-04-08 08:31

我也有点晕

热心网友 时间:2022-04-08 12:02

从第一范式开始,然后后者是在前者的基础上,继续分类的,不懂问我我可以详细和你解释!

热心网友 时间:2022-04-08 15:50

你说的这些概念太乱了,我都头都大了,不太明白。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
魔兽世界80牧师治疗天赋 魔兽世界80级牧师加血还强大么? 上海自驾游最全攻略,短途无比惊艳的自驾游 请问去新疆旅游,什么季节最合适? 不正创是什么意思? 知识产权侵权责任承担形式有哪些 完全产权是什么意思? 产权错位是什么意思? 抖音通知设置为什么没有全部? 巴黎欧莱雅男士劲能醒肤露如何通过创新成分提升皮肤防护和活力? 8寸照片尺寸是多少 数据库的三大范氏是什么 8寸照片有多大? 数据库三范式是什么? 数据库三大范式是什么? 八寸照片多大 数据库三范式具体是? 数据库中的三大范式是什么? 8寸相片的尺寸是多少? 8寸照片的尺寸是多少 8寸照片尺寸多少厘米? 8寸的照片是几厘米*几厘米? 8寸的照片有多大? 数据库三大范式究竟是什么? 八寸照片尺寸是多少? 用QQ号可以注册吗 怎样用qq注册 我们中国人用的是百度地图来看地图外国人用的是什么来看地图? 百度地图主要使用了什么空间信息技术? 百度地图的地图数据用的是哪家公司的? 数据库三大范式通俗理解是什么? 范式和反范式是什么意思,数据库相关问题。 数据库的第三范式是什么意思? 谁能知道数据库中的一,二,三范式怎么判断!!!不要网页上得到的!!!拜托各位了 3Q 什么是反范式 数据库的逆规范化 数据库中的范示是怎么回事? 如何设计多行多列的数据库表 数据库三大范式起什么作用? 小程序用户画像中的地区分布是怎么定位的? 地域属于什么标签类型 重疾险的核心用户画像包括哪四类? 必应搜索的用户群体是? 有案底的人可以做代驾吗? 用户画像分析报告 代驾有案底可以做吗 盖得李铁做什么的? 盖得排行的依据可信吗? 做过牢的人能做代驾员吗? 哪些行业适合做商城小程序,都有哪些优势 有案底能做代驾吗